Mohamed Salah Faced with Liverpool Transfer Decision as Lucrative Saudi Proposal Mooted

The Offer from Al-Ittihad

Liverpool star forward Mohamed Salah has been presented with a lucrative offer from Saudi Arabian champions Al-Ittihad, which, if accepted, would make him the world’s highest-paid player. The offer is reported to exceed Cristiano Ronaldo’s salary at Al-Nassr, amounting to £173 million per year.

Despite the offer, Liverpool has made it clear that they have no intention of selling Salah, as he remains a central figure in their plans for the upcoming season. Salah’s agent has also stated that the player is not looking to leave Liverpool this year.

The Departure of Star Players from Liverpool

Liverpool has already experienced the departure of several star players to the Middle East this summer. Club captain Jordan Henderson joined Al-Ettifaq, while Fabinho was signed by Al-Ittihad. The latter club is particularly keen on reuniting the Brazilian midfielder with Salah. Additionally, Roberto Firmino left Anfield as a free agent, joining Al-Ahli, while former Liverpool star Sadio Mane joined Ronaldo at Al-Nassr after an unsuccessful season with Bayern Munich.

Salah’s Potential Openness to the Move

According to reports, Al-Ittihad representatives have already met with Salah’s entourage in Dubai to present their offer. Salah’s openness to these discussions suggests that he may be considering the move to the Middle East. It is believed that Salah’s strong religious beliefs make him receptive to the idea of playing in that region.

A Mouth-Watering Partnership with Karim Benzema

In addition to signing Fabinho, Al-Ittihad has also secured the services of Ballon d’Or winner Karim Benzema. A potential partnership between Salah and Benzema would undoubtedly be an exciting prospect. However, it is worth noting that Benzema has had some issues with new manager Nuno Espirito Santo at the current league champions.

Liverpool Manager Jurgen Klopp’s Concerns

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p has expressed his concerns about the Saudi transfer window closing on September 20, three weeks later than its European counterparts. Klopp believes that UEFA or FIFA should address this discrepancy.

The Al-Ittihad Investment and Club World Cup Aspirations

One of the central motives behind Al-Ittihad’s investment is Saudi Arabia’s belief that the club can win this year’s Club World Cup, which will be hosted in the nation. As the champions of the Saudi Arabian league, Nuno Espirito Santo’s side will participate in the tournament. Other teams competing in the tournament include Manchester City, Leon of Mexico, Japanese side Urawa Red Diamonds, Al Ahly from Egypt, New Zealand’s Auckland City, and the winner of the South American Copa Libertadores championship.
